Pelvic Tilt

Foundational low-back control — small motion, big teaching value.

How to do it

  1. Lie on your back, knees bent, feet flat.
  2. Flatten your low back into the floor by gently tightening your abdomen and tilting the pelvis.
  3. Hold 5 seconds, release. 10 repetitions.
  4. Progress by holding while breathing normally.

⚠ Cautions

This should feel like effort, never pain. It's the starting block for most low-back strengthening — master it before bigger moves.
